在线咨询
案例分析

APP开发案例深度解析:成功要素

微易网络
2026年2月18日 02:59
0 次阅读
APP开发案例深度解析:成功要素

本文通过解析智能搜索、房产行业和大数据分析平台三个典型APP开发案例,深度剖析了成功应用背后的关键要素。文章指出,成功的APP开发不仅需要坚实的技术架构,更依赖于精准的市场洞察与卓越的用户体验设计。例如,智能搜索功能的核心在于实现语义理解、场景适配与高性能响应。这些案例为开发者和产品经理提供了将用户需求、技术创新与业务目标紧密结合的实用路径与经验借鉴。

APP开发案例深度解析:成功要素

在移动互联网竞争白热化的今天,一个成功的APP绝非偶然。它往往是精准的市场洞察、卓越的用户体验与坚实的技术架构共同作用的结果。本文将通过三个典型行业案例——搜索功能案例房产行业案例大数据分析平台案例,深度解析其背后的成功要素,为开发者与产品经理提供可借鉴的实践经验。

案例一:智能搜索功能——从“找到”到“懂你”

搜索是许多APP的核心功能,其体验好坏直接决定用户留存。一个成功的搜索功能案例,其成功要素在于智能化、场景化和高性能

成功要素解析

1. 语义理解与分词优化: 传统的关键词匹配已无法满足需求。引入自然语言处理(NLP)技术,使搜索能理解用户意图。例如,用户输入“北京朝阳区带阳台的两居室”,系统需要精准拆分为地点(北京、朝阳区)、属性(带阳台)、户型(两居室)等多个维度。这背后依赖于定制化的分词词典和实体识别模型。

// 示例:使用结巴分词进行基础分词与自定义词典
import jieba
jieba.load_userdict("real_estate_dict.txt") // 加载房产行业专属词典
seg_list = jieba.cut_for_search("北京朝阳区带阳台的精装两居室")
print("/ ".join(seg_list))
// 输出:北京 / 朝阳区 / 带 / 阳台 / 的 / 精装 / 两居 / 两居室

2. 联想与纠错: 在用户输入过程中提供实时联想(Suggest),能极大提升效率。同时,拼写纠错功能不可或缺。这通常通过构建前缀树(Trie树)存储热门搜索词,并结合编辑距离算法(如Levenshtein Distance)实现纠错。

// 简化的前缀树节点结构(用于联想词)
class TrieNode {
    constructor() {
        this.children = {};
        this.isEndOfWord = false;
        this.popularity = 0; // 热度值,用于排序
    }
}

3. 多维度排序与过滤: 搜索结果不能简单按时间或相关性排序。成功的搜索会综合文本相关性、业务权重(如付费推广)、用户个性化偏好(历史点击)及实时热度进行加权排序。技术上,这常基于Elasticsearch或类似搜索引擎实现,利用其强大的打分机制(如BM25)和聚合能力。

案例二:房产行业APP——连接线上与线下的桥梁

房产APP复杂度高,涉及房源(海量图片/视频)、经纪人、地图、即时通讯、交易流程等多个模块。其成功要素在于数据真实性、服务闭环与沉浸式体验

成功要素解析

1. 房源数据的结构化与去重: 房产APP的核心资产是房源。成功案例会投入大量技术资源进行房源清洗、去重和结构化。例如,通过地址标准化、图片相似度比对(如感知哈希算法)和经纪人信用体系,从源头保障数据真实可靠。

2. 地图与VR/AR技术的深度集成: 静态图片已不够。集成高德/百度地图SDK,实现精准小区定位、周边配套可视化。更进一步,引入VR看房和AR摆件技术,提供沉浸式看房体验。这需要处理大量的3D模型和实时视频流数据,对客户端渲染和网络传输优化要求极高。

// 示例:使用高德地图SDK添加一个房源标记点
// Android端简化代码
MarkerOptions markerOption = new MarkerOptions();
markerOption.position(new LatLng(39.90923, 116.397428));
markerOption.title("XX小区 3室2厅");
markerOption.snippet("均价 85000元/平米");
aMap.addMarker(markerOption);

3. 构建高效的IM与日程系统: 连接用户与经纪人是关键。集成第三方IM SDK(如融云、环信)或自研,需确保消息的及时、可靠,并支持富媒体(房源卡片、合同文件)。同时,集成的在线预约看房日程系统,需要与经纪人的后台日程实时同步,避免冲突。

案例三:大数据分析平台APP——让数据驱动决策

面向企业或高级用户的移动端数据分析平台,其成功要素在于复杂数据的可视化、实时性以及交互的流畅性。目标是在小屏幕上清晰呈现关键指标(KPI)。

成功要素解析

1. 响应式图表与性能优化: 移动端屏幕尺寸多样,图表库必须支持响应式设计。常用的技术栈如ECharts或AntV的移动端版本。对于海量数据(如上万条时间序列点),需采用数据采样、分片加载和WebGL渲染来保证流畅性。

// 示例:使用ECharts配置一个基础的移动端折线图
option = {
    tooltip: { trigger: 'axis' },
    grid: { left: '3%', right: '4%', bottom: '3%', containLabel: true },
    xAxis: { type: 'category', data: ['周一','周二','周三','周四','周五','周六','周日'] },
    yAxis: { type: 'value' },
    series: [{
        data: [820, 932, 901, 934, 1290, 1330, 1320],
        type: 'line',
        smooth: true
    }]
};

2. 灵活的筛选与下钻分析: 用户需要从总览快速下钻到细节。这要求前端设计灵活的筛选器组件(如多级联动选择、时间范围选择),并与后端API良好协作,支持按维度(如地区、产品线)和指标(如销售额、增长率)的快速下钻查询。后端通常依赖列式数据库(如ClickHouse)或OLAP引擎提供亚秒级响应。

3. 离线缓存与数据同步: 考虑到用户可能在网络环境不佳的场合查看数据,成功的APP会实现智能的离线缓存策略。例如,使用SQLite或Realm缓存用户最近查看的报表数据,并在网络恢复后静默同步更新。这涉及到复杂的状态管理和冲突解决。

  • 技术要点:
  • 使用RxJavaCombine处理异步数据流。
  • 采用DiffUtil(Android)或Diffable DataSource(iOS)高效更新列表/表格视图。
  • 图表数据采用增量更新而非全量刷新。

总结:跨越行业的共通成功要素

通过对以上三个不同行业APP案例的解析,我们可以提炼出一些共通的、至关重要的成功要素:

  • 以用户为中心的核心功能打磨: 无论是搜索的“智能化”、房产的“沉浸式看房”还是数据分析的“可视化下钻”,成功都始于对用户核心痛点的深刻理解和极致解决。
  • 坚实而灵活的技术架构: 面对海量数据、高并发或复杂交互,选择合适的技术栈(如Elasticsearch、专用地图SDK、高性能图表库)并做好性能优化是基础。
  • 数据质量与算法赋能: 数据是新时代的“石油”。确保数据的真实、准确、结构化,并恰当运用算法(NLP、图像识别、推荐算法)提升产品智能,是构建竞争壁垒的关键。
  • 全链路体验的流畅性: 从网络请求到界面渲染,从离线到在线,确保每一个交互环节都快速、稳定、可预期。这需要前后端、客户端的紧密协作与深度优化。

归根结底,一个成功的APP开发项目,是产品思维、技术实现与商业逻辑的完美结合。它要求团队不仅要有实现功能的能力,更要有定义问题、架构系统和持续优化的远见与执行力。希望本文的案例解析能为您的下一个项目带来启发。

微易网络

技术作者

2026年2月18日
0 次阅读

文章分类

案例分析

需要技术支持?

专业团队为您提供一站式软件开发服务

相关推荐

您可能还对这些文章感兴趣

教育行业案例深度解析:成功要素
案例分析

教育行业案例深度解析:成功要素

这篇文章跟咱们教育行业的老朋友聊了个实在话题。它分享了现在很多机构遇到的痛点:学生留不住、盗版猖獗、活动效果看不清。文章的核心观点是,这些问题根子出在“连接”和“信任”上。接着它用真实的案例,掰开揉碎地讲解了怎么用“一物一码”这个工具,像搭电商平台一样,去破解这些难题,第一步就是解决如何让每个学生真正“在线”的问题。

2026/3/14
大数据分析平台案例深度解析:成功要素
案例分析

大数据分析平台案例深度解析:成功要素

这篇文章讲了一个很实在的话题:很多企业花大钱建大数据平台,最后却成了没人用的面子工程。作者结合几个真实案例,比如快消品公司、AI客服和DevOps优化的故事,分享了大数据平台要成功的关键。核心观点是,平台不能只是技术的堆砌,必须有“用户思维”,真正解决业务部门的痛点,从“报表生成机”变成业务的“决策伙伴”。说白了,成功不在于技术多牛,而在于能不能用起来、帮上忙。

2026/3/12
用户增长黑客案例分析深度解析:成功要素
案例分析

用户增长黑客案例分析深度解析:成功要素

这篇文章讲了现在做用户增长不能光靠砸钱,得学学“增长黑客”们四两拨千斤的方法。文章结合了真实的音视频等案例,分享了几个关键的成功要素。比如,第一步不是自嗨做功能,而是要真正理解用户的需求和痛点,钻进用户脑子里去想问题。说白了,就是教我们怎么用更聪明、更精细的策略,把用户实实在在地留下来、活跃起来。

2026/3/11
房产行业案例深度解析:成功要素
案例分析

房产行业案例深度解析:成功要素

这篇文章讲了房产销售的一个新思路。现在房子难卖,客户来了又走,广告费花得不明不白,问题出在哪?文章分享说,关键是缺了一座连接你和客户的“数字桥梁”。它用一个真实案例解析,如何通过给每户业主的“新家礼盒”贴二维码,把一次性的交房变成长期服务的开始,把“失联”的客户变成可以持续经营的终身用户,从根本上改变传统的卖房模式。

2026/3/11

需要专业的软件开发服务?

郑州微易网络科技有限公司,15+年开发经验,为您提供专业的小程序开发、网站建设、软件定制服务

技术支持:186-8889-0335 | 邮箱:hicpu@me.com